Output 3617fe6984572311242e757bb3d81d06f48c8a0e7eeced1bf333147e3dd94e5e:38

value
18325
script pubkey
OP_0 OP_PUSHBYTES_20 577edcab948a367ba7350a5df9f6a1b0f6531134
address
bc1q2alde2u53gm8hfe4pfwlna4pkrm9xyf5vww5jq
transaction
3617fe6984572311242e757bb3d81d06f48c8a0e7eeced1bf333147e3dd94e5e
spent
true